Carbon Steel
A333 Grade 6
ASTM A333 Grade 6 is the standard specification for seamless and welded steel pipe for low-temperature service. It requires Charpy V-Notch impact testing at -45°C (-50°F) to ensure toughness in cryogenic applications.
Key Features
- Low-temperature service - Impact tested at -45°C
- Seamless & Welded - Available in both constructions
- High toughness - Excellent resistance to brittle fracture
- Weldability - Good weldability with appropriate procedures
Applications
- Cryogenic piping systems
- Refrigeration plants
- Compressed gas storage
- Chemical processing at low temperatures
Chemical Composition
| Element | Composition |
|---|---|
| Carbon | 0.30% max |
| Manganese | 0.29-1.06% |
| Phosphorus | 0.025% max |
| Sulfur | 0.025% max |
| Silicon | 0.10% min |
Mechanical Properties
| Property | Value |
|---|---|
| Tensile Strength | 415 MPa (60 ksi) min |
| Yield Strength | 240 MPa (35 ksi) min |
| Elongation | 30% min |
Size Range
- Diameter: NPS 1/8" to NPS 24"
- Wall Thickness: Schedule 10 to XXS
